Campaigns split so you can tell what is working: brand defence, category attack, and harvesting kept apart instead of averaged into one ACOS number.
Converting terms promoted to exact, wasteful ones negated. This is the unglamorous weekly job that most accounts are not actually getting.
You decide whether this quarter is about profitability or share. We hold the account to that number and tell you plainly when it is not achievable.
Prime Day and Black Friday need someone watching budgets during the UK trading day, not reading about the overspend the next morning.
Traffic is wasted on a weak listing. We fix the images and copy the clicks land on, rather than reporting a conversion-rate problem and stopping there.
You get the account, the logic and the numbers. If we leave, nothing goes with us — the structure and the learnings stay in your account.
Structural changes need two to four weeks to gather enough data to judge, and roughly a quarter to show a stable trend. Anyone promising a turnaround in days is guessing.
